java中出现这提示是表达什么,而import java.util.*;这句话的作用是?

如题所述

第一处,指的是你需要使用某一个包里面的方法,更清楚点是,java为了便于组织,吧各种类放在各种包里面,除了java启动需要的system和runtime的包以外,其他方法放在包中,需要自己去调用,import java.util.*是指所有在util包当中的方法都可以使用了,这个是为编译器制定方法目录的,具体的包和方法的组织情况可以查看chm书
第二处,指的是这个地方存在警告,也就是说这个地方可以使用,但是容易出现错误,比如java现在的泛型机制,或者方法返回值出现了窄化处理,比如你把Object转为User,可能失败,因此会出现警告
温馨提示:内容为网友见解,仅供参考
第1个回答  2015-11-14
黄色感叹号是警告信息,及代码改进建议。
import java.util.*是导入java.util目录下所有的类,以供代码中调用。不import则代码中不能使用这些类。
第2个回答  2017-01-18
util是utiliy的缩写,意为多用途的,工具性质的包 这个包中主要存放了:集合类(如ArrayList,HashMap等),随机数产生类,属性文件读取类,定时器类等类。 这些类极大方便了Java编程,日常java编程中,经常要用到这些类。
第3个回答  2015-11-14
Enumeration使用泛型,Enumeration<String> 这样子就不会提示,import 是引入java程序需要的工具包

java里面import java.util.*;是什么用处?
import java.util.*;导入 java.util包中的类接口。Java中import的作用是导入要用到的包中的类接口。import就是在java文件开头的地方,先说明会用到那些类别。 接着我们就能在代码中只用类名指定某个类,也就是只称呼名字,不称呼他的姓。这其中包的作用就是给java类进行分拣分类,不同业务逻辑的java...

java里面import java.util.*;是什么用处
java.util.Scanner sc = new java.util.Scanner();而import java.util.*;代表你导入了java.util包中的所有类,,这样的话你使用 Scanner就没那么麻烦了Scanner sc = new Scanner();

能再问一下,import java.util.*;是什么意思么,为什么出现在第一行?
它的作用是导入完整的实用工具(Utility)库,该库属于标准Java开发工具包的一部分。java.util库中,有很多常用的接口和类。比如集合(List,Map等等)在一个程序里面,通常第一行是 package xx.xx.xx;然后下面才是import xx.xx.xx;package xx.xx.xx; 这句话的意思是,将该类放入xx.xx.xx;包中。...

在java中这句语言“import java.util.Scanner;”是什么意思
回答:一个可以使用正则表达式来解析基本类型和字符串的简单文本扫描器。 Scanner 使用分隔符模式将其输入分解为标记,默认情况下该分隔符模式与空白匹配。然后可以使用不同的 next 方法将得到的标记转换为不同类型的值。 例如,以下代码使用户能够从 System.in 中读取一个数: Scanner sc = new Scanner(Sy...

import java.util.*;和import java.util.Scanner;有什么区别
1、“importjava.util.*;”表示的是把util这个包下的全部类导入到程序中;而“importjava.util.Scanner;”表示的是只把util包下的Scanner类导入到程序中;2、导入“importjava.util.*;”后程序中后面如果要用到util包里面的别的类都不需要再重新导入包了,而如果导入“importjava.util.Scanner;”的...

import java.util.*;什么意思?
表示这个包下的所有类库(不包括子包)这句话就是向你写的类里面导入这个包下的所有类库,因为你写的类里面有方法用到了这个包里面的类。这些基础问题可以用Hi问我。

在java编程中~什么时候需要引入import java.util.*;这条语句~
使用这句话的时候,是指你将Java中util包下的所有工具类都导进来,一般不会写这句话,我们写的话,是用到了哪一个工具就直接导进来那个工具类,例如我用到了随机数,就会导入java.util.Random;...类似这样的。

java里 import java.util.Scanner;的意思
另附import的作用:1,加载已定义好的类或包 2,导入支持类(可以是JDK基础类或者自己编写的类),可以供本类调用方法和属性。 import导入声明可分为两中导入声明可分为两中导入声明可分为两中导入声明可分为两中: 1>单类型导入单类型导入单类型导入单类型导入(single-type-import) 例例例...

import java.util.*是什么意思?
这句话的意思是引入java.util.*下面所有的类 这样写可以减少一部分代码量,不过个人建议不要这么写,对程序的性能还是有点影响的(纯属个人见解,不喜勿喷,如有错误欢迎指正)

java 中import java.util.List(Ljava.lang.Integer;); 这个是干什么的...
import表示引入某个类或者文件。正确写法应该是import java.util.List;说明程序中要用到List这个类的相关方法,如果没有用到List这个类,当然可以不加这一句。如果用到而不加这个引用,则会出现编译时错误。Ljava.lang.Integer;这个应该是不正确的,除非是自己写的包。如果想引入java.lang.Integer,这个...

相似回答